Asphalt Driveway Lifespan in Lebanon, TN: What to Expect

Asphalt Driveway Lifespan in Lebanon, TN: What to Expect How Long Does Asphalt Last in Lebanon, TN? Take a drive through the neighborhoods off Hillcrest Drive or head out toward Sparta Pike and the contrast jumps right out at you. Some driveways still look great after fifteen years. Others are falling apart at the edges before they even hit year five. That’s not random. It comes down to how the driveway was built and whether it was designed for Lebanon’s clay soil, summer heat, and winter freeze-thaw cycles. After three decades paving across Wilson County, we’ve seen what helps a driveway last and what causes it to fail early.This guide lays out what you can realistically expect, what shortens that timeline, and how to protect what you spend. If you already know it’s time, our Lebanon paving contractor team can come walk the property and give it to you straight. How Long Should an Asphalt Driveway Last Here? A well built asphalt driveway in Lebanon should give you 15 to 20 years, and longer if you stay on top of it. Cut corners on the install and you might be looking at a redo in 5 to 8. Here’s what most people miss: the lifespan is decided before a drop of asphalt goes down. It’s all about what’s underneath. A solid gravel base and drainage that actually moves water away matter more than the blacktop on top. Get that foundation wrong and the best asphalt in the world won’t save it. Our weather is kinder than what they deal with up north, sure. But that Tennessee clay and summer humidity still put every driveway to the test. Build it for our conditions and it’ll earn its keep for two decades easy. Why Do Asphalt Driveways Crack in Middle Tennessee? Cracks here usually come down to water, shifting soil, and maintenance that got skipped, not the asphalt just wearing out. And water tops that list every time. It’s a slow problem that sneaks up on you. A tiny crack lets water seep in, the temperature drops, the water expands, and suddenly that hairline is a real gap. Do that over a few Tennessee cold snaps and a little line turns into something structural. Our clay makes it worse too, swelling when it’s wet and shrinking when it dries, tugging at the surface from below. Staying ahead of it is the whole point of regular crack sealing. How Lebanon’s Climate and Soil Affect Your Driveway Between humid summers, winters that freeze and thaw, and clay soil that won’t sit still, Lebanon throws about everything it can at a driveway. And each one does its damage in a different way. Summer’s the slow burn. Heat softens the asphalt and speeds up oxidation, which is what fades that fresh black surface into a dry, brittle gray. Winter flips the script. Water sneaks into the smallest cracks, freezes, and pries them wider every time the temperature swings. Then you’ve got the clay, which might be the sneakiest of all. Plenty of properties out near Cedars of Lebanon State Park sit on soil that swells and shrinks with the moisture. If the grading and drainage weren’t done right from the start, all that movement works its way up and shows up as cracks on top. That’s exactly why a crew that knows Lebanon dirt beats a cheap quote from some out of town outfit. What Are the Warning Signs of a Failing Driveway? The first things you’ll notice are fading color, surface cracks, and small potholes settling into low spots. Catch them early and the fix stays cheap. Keep an eye out for: Cracks wider than a quarter inch Water that pools and sits after a rain Edges that are crumbling or breaking off A surface that looks gray, dry, and brittle Potholes or spots that feel soft when you walk them A handful of surface cracks usually just needs some asphalt repair or a resurface. But if the cracking is spreading into that alligator pattern and the base is going, you’re probably looking at replacement. How Do You Make an Asphalt Driveway Last Longer? Two habits do more than anything else: sealcoat every two to three years, and seal cracks the moment they show up. Both cost next to nothing compared to repaving. Sealcoating puts back that protective top layer that keeps water, sun, and oil from eating into the surface. Skip it and the asphalt dries out and ages fast. A simple Lebanon routine looks like this: Seal new cracks before winter sets in Sealcoat every 2 to 3 years Keep standing water and debris off it Clean up oil stains quick Patch small potholes before they grow Homeowners who actually stick to this push their driveways well past twenty years. It’s not much work, but it pays off big. When Is the Best Time to Pave in Lebanon? Late spring through early fall is the sweet spot, when daytime temps stay above 60 degrees pretty reliably. Warm and dry lets the asphalt cure and pack down the way it should. Paving when it’s cold risks weak compaction and a driveway that doesn’t last. Our long warm season gives Lebanon folks a generous window, but the good slots book up fast. If you’re planning a new install or a full driveway replacement, getting on the schedule early in the season gives it the best possible start. Frequently Asked Questions How long does asphalt last in Tennessee? Most driveways here run 15 to 20 years when they’re built right. Stay on top of sealcoating and crack repair and you’ll squeeze out even more. How soon can I drive on a new asphalt driveway? Give it 24 to 72 hours before driving on it. For heavy vehicles or sharp turns, wait closer to 30 days so it fully sets. Is sealcoating really worth the money in Lebanon? It is. When Does Commercial Asphalt Need Replacing In Lebanon, TN

When Does Commercial Asphalt Need Replacing In Lebanon, TN When Does Commercial Asphalt Need Replacing? Out of everything Wilson County business owners ask us, this one comes up the most. Once a new lot goes down near the Fairgrounds or along Highway 109, the very next thought is how many years before it needs work again. That’s a smart way to think about it. A parking lot is a serious line item, and the answer depends a lot on where you are and how the surface gets treated. We’ve poured and maintained commercial surfaces around Lebanon for three decades, so we’ve watched lots age in real time across this exact climate and soil. Below is what actually drives asphalt lifespan here, what cuts it short, and how to stretch every year out of your investment before you ever need to call about commercial asphalt paving in Lebanon. How Long Does Commercial Asphalt Last in Lebanon, TN? A properly installed commercial asphalt lot in Lebanon typically lasts 15 to 20 years. That range assumes a solid base, correct drainage, and routine upkeep along the way. Skip the maintenance and that number drops fast. We’ve seen lots fail in under five years when the base was rushed or water was never managed. The asphalt surface itself is only as good as what sits underneath it. What Shortens the Life of a Commercial Parking Lot? The biggest killers are water, weight, and neglect. Standing water works into small cracks, heavy trucks flex the surface, and untreated damage spreads quietly until it’s expensive. Around here, logistics traffic off Highway 109 is brutal on pavement. Constant loaded axles compress the base and open up rutting. If the original install didn’t account for that load, the clock starts ticking early. Poor edge support is another one. When a lot’s perimeter isn’t backed by proper curbing, the edges crumble first and pull damage inward. How Tennessee Weather Affects Your Asphalt Middle Tennessee’s freezing and thawing swings are one of the hardest things on local asphalt. Water seeps into hairline cracks, freezes, expands, then melts, prying the crack wider every cycle. Our summers add the second punch. Heat softens asphalt, and combined with sun exposure it dries out the binder that holds everything together. That’s how a smooth lot turns gray, brittle, and crack prone. Soil matters too. The clay common near Cedar Creek shifts with moisture, and that movement transfers straight up into the pavement. Lots built without that in mind tend to develop the same drainage and settling issues year after year. Warning Signs Your Lot Is Wearing Out The earliest signs are surface fading, small cracks, and water pooling after rain. Catch those and you usually have a maintenance problem, not a replacement problem. Watch for alligator cracking, where the surface looks like scaled skin. That pattern means the base below is failing, not just the top layer. Potholes, sunken spots, and crumbling edges fall in the same category. When you start seeing those deeper issues, it’s worth a professional look before small repairs stop being enough. How to Make Commercial Asphalt Last Longer The single best move is staying ahead of water and filling cracks early. Sealing out moisture before it reaches the base is what separates a 20 year lot from a 7 year one. A simple rhythm works well here: Seal cracks as soon as they appear, not after they spread Keep drainage clear so water never sits on the surface Schedule parking lot maintenance on a regular cadence Address heavy traffic wear zones before they rut None of this is glamorous, but it’s cheaper than repaving and it protects the surface you already paid for. Does Sealcoating Really Extend Asphalt Life? Yes. A quality sealcoat acts like sunscreen and a raincoat for your pavement, blocking UV damage and water intrusion at the same time. Most Lebanon lots benefit from sealcoating every two to three years, depending on traffic. It restores that dark finish, slows oxidation, and adds years before resurfacing ever enters the conversation. Paired with fresh striping, it also keeps the lot looking sharp for customers. Repair or Repave: Which One Makes Sense? If damage is on the surface, repair. If the base has failed, repave. That’s the simplest way to think about it. Localized cracking, isolated potholes, and worn striping are repair territory. Widespread alligator cracking, deep settling, or recurring failures in the same spots usually mean the foundation is done, and patching just delays the inevitable. A quick on site assessment settles it either way. Frequently Asked Questions How often should commercial asphalt be sealcoated in Lebanon?  Most commercial lots in Lebanon should be sealcoated every two to three years. Heavy traffic properties may need it sooner to stay protected. Can a cracked parking lot be saved without repaving?  Often, yes. Crack filling and sealcoating can extend a surface for years if the base is still solid and damage is caught early. Why does my new asphalt already have cracks?  Early cracking usually points to a rushed base, poor drainage, or skipped compaction. Quality installation in Wilson County should not crack within months. Does weather in Tennessee really damage asphalt that much?  It does. Freezing and thawing swings plus summer heat break down asphalt faster here than in milder climates, especially without regular sealing. What’s the best time of year to repave in Middle Tennessee?  Late spring through early fall is ideal. Warmer, drier conditions help asphalt cure properly and bond well for a longer lasting surface.
